A customer information file (CIF) is a unique 11-digit number that a bank issues to each customer that contains confidential information like KYC (Know Your Customer) details, bank details and other personal details such as name, birth date, age, etc. CIFs are used in financial institutions to represent a customer's existing products, accounts and related details. Customer Information File (CIF) numbers can normally be found on a bank's passbook or chequebook. You may also check it using your net banking or mobile banking account. Steps to get your CIF Number of HDFC Bank through net banking
Every customer who has a savings/ current account with HDFC Bank is issued a Customer ID, which is a unique identifying number. In the event of non-individuals (companies, trusts, HUFs, etc.), the individual's customer ID is required to log in to the net banking account.
- Visit https://netbanking.hdfcbank.com/netbanking/ and click on the 'Forgot Customer ID' link.
- Now enter your registered mobile number with the country code, date of birth/PAN details and the security code.
- Now click on 'Continue' to proceed and on the next page authenticate your request by entering the OTP (one-time password) received on your registered mobile number.
- Click on 'Continue' to proceed further and your customer ID will be displayed on the screen.
- You can now log in to your net banking account using the customer ID.
Note: NRI or NRE customers can use their date of birth to get Customer ID details. If you are an authorised signatory of a firm, company, trust, or other non-individual entity, you can get the customer ID using the PAN details of your entity. And if you are a HUF Karta, you can get the customer ID using the PAN details of your Hindu Undivided Family (HUF). The CIF number will not be displayed online if there are multiple Customer IDs with the same details according to HDFC Bank.
Steps to get your CIF Number of HDFC Bank through mobile banking
Customers having a mobile banking account of HDFC, can follow the steps below to get customer ID details online.
- Open the HDFC Bank mobile app and log in to your account using the required credentials.
- Now tap on the menu icon, located at the top-left side of the homepage.
- Tap on 'Your Profile' section and from the drop-down list, select 'Personal Profile'.
- On the 'Personal Profile' section, you will get your Customer ID displayed on the screen.
How to get your CIF Number of HDFC Bank offline?
Customers with an HDFC Bank Savings/ Current Account can get the CIF number by checking their account statement, passbook, or cheque book. Customers can get their customer ID at the top of their account statement slip. Customers can find their customer ID details on the first page of their passbook. Customers should refer to the 'Welcome Letter' for Customer ID for new regular accounts opened at HDFC Bank. Customers can find their CIF number on the first page of their cheque book also. If you fail to find your Customer ID through online banking, you can call the PhoneBanking number in your city for more information.
